About SupremeFX
Overview
Supreme FX is a forex and CFD brokerage operated by Sun Capital Markets Ltd, registered in Seychelles since May 2022. The company positions itself as a client-focused firm with a team of professionals across analysis, customer service, and legal departments. It aims to provide a supportive trading environment, particularly for less experienced traders.
The broker is headquartered at CT House, Office 4E, Providence, Mahe, Seychelles, and reports zero employees on its registration—though this may reflect its operational structure rather than actual staff count. Supreme FX offers three account tiers and promotes itself as a regulated entity under the Seychelles Financial Services Authority (FSA).
Regulation
Supreme FX holds a Derivatives Trading License (EP) from the Seychelles FSA, classified as an offshore regulation. The FSA is a less stringent regulator compared to top-tier authorities like the FCA or CySEC, meaning client protections such as negative balance protection or compensation schemes may be limited. Traders should be aware that offshore regulation often involves reduced oversight.
The broker's license status can be verified on the FSA's public register, but investors should weigh the implications of an offshore regulator before committing funds.
Account Types and Features
Supreme FX offers three account types to cater to different trader profiles. The Standard account requires a minimum deposit of $200 and offers leverage up to 1:500, with spreads from 1.2 pips. The Advanced account requires $1,000, also with 1:500 leverage, spreads from 0.8 pips, and zero commission. The PRO account, designed for serious traders, requires $2,500, offers leverage up to 1:200, spreads from 0.1 to 0.2 pips, and zero commission.
All accounts appear to be swap-free and commission-free, though the broker does not disclose the full list of tradable instruments or specific platform providers. The account structure suggests a focus on retail traders, with the Standard tier being accessible to newcomers.
Deposits and Withdrawals
Specific deposit and withdrawal methods are not publicly disclosed by Supreme FX. However, user reviews indicate that deposits are generally processed smoothly, with some mentioning support for popular methods like PayPal. Withdrawal experiences vary widely: some clients report instant payouts, while others describe significant delays or partial refunds.
The broker does not specify minimum or maximum withdrawal amounts, or any associated fees. The lack of transparent information on funding methods is a drawback for traders who prefer clarity upfront.
Trading Instruments and Platforms
Supreme FX does not publicly list its tradable instruments or the trading platforms it supports. Based on user mentions, it likely offers forex, commodities, and indices, but this cannot be confirmed from the provided data. The platform is described by some users as user-friendly, but no specific platform name (e.g., MetaTrader) is mentioned.
Potential clients should contact the broker directly for a full list of instruments and platform details before opening an account.
Target Audience
Given the low minimum deposit and educational support highlighted in reviews, Supreme FX appears to target beginner and intermediate retail traders. The availability of swap-free and commission-free accounts may appeal to traders adhering to certain religious principles or those seeking low-cost trading. The higher-tier PRO account also caters to more active traders who demand tighter spreads.
However, the offshore regulation and mixed user feedback suggest that risk-averse traders or those with substantial capital may want to consider alternatives with stronger regulatory protections.
